THE Nicky Larson of Netflix is revealed
After the success of the live action series A pieceNetflix has decided to tackle another cult manga: Nicky Larson. This time it is with a Japanese film that the streaming platform will try to attract mass subscribers. Even though Tsukasa Hojo’s work was created in 1985, the character remains very popular today. Series lively Nicky Larson (1987-1991) had contributed greatly to the success of the manga and several films were subsequently produced. Animated films, like the last one Nicky Larson – City Hunter: Angel Dustand live entertainment of all kinds, such as Nicky Larson and Cupid’s perfume (2019) by Philippe Lacheau.

Which Netflix in turn offers a film Nicky Larson it is therefore not aberrant and enthusiasts will soon be able to discover it. Ahead of the feature film’s release, he revealed the streaming service a first trailer (video on the front page of an article). And the least we can say is that the spirit of the manga will be very present. From the first images we discover the hero observing young women in bathing suits. It is this character trait of the character that has always amused him, because he is shown in a ridiculous and unusual way.
Hence, the promotional video emphasizes action and drama. We are in fact witnessing the death of Nicky Larson’s partner, Toni. Before dying, the latter asks him to protect him his sister Laura. Together they will try to avenge Toni. Netflix therefore decided to tell the detective’s story from the beginning. A choice that shouldn’t displease fans. Finally, even if the film isn’t a masterpiece, the proposal seems honest. The final result will be waiting to be discovered April 25 on Netflixwith Ryohei Suzuki and Misato Morita in the two main roles.
